2 John 1-2
International Children’s Bible
Do Not Help False Teachers
1 From the Elder.[a]
To the chosen lady[b] and to her children:
I love all of you in the truth.[c] Also, all those who know the truth love you. 2 We love you because of the truth—the truth that lives in us and will be with us forever.

- 1 Elder This is probably John the apostle. “Elder” means an older man. It can also mean a special leader in the church (as in Titus 1:5).
- 1 lady This might mean a woman. Or, in this letter, it might mean a church. If it is a church, then “her children” would be the people of the church.
- 1 truth The truth or “Good News” about Jesus Christ that joins all believers together.
2 John 1-2
King James Version
1 The elder unto the elect lady and her children, whom I love in the truth; and not I only, but also all they that have known the truth;
2 For the truth's sake, which dwelleth in us, and shall be with us for ever.
